What is a multistep equation?

Back

A multistep equation is an equation that requires more than one step to solve, often involving combining like terms, using the distributive property, and isolating the variable.

What does it mean to have variables on both sides of an equation?

Back

Having variables on both sides of an equation means that the variable appears on both the left and right sides, requiring manipulation to isolate the variable.

How do you solve the equation 3(s+2)-s=38?

Back

First, distribute: 3s + 6 - s = 38. Combine like terms: 2s + 6 = 38. Subtract 6 from both sides: 2s = 32. Divide by 2: s = 16.

How do you isolate the variable in the equation 2x - 3 + 4x = 27?

Back

Combine like terms: 6x - 3 = 27. Add 3 to both sides: 6x = 30. Divide by 6: x = 5.

What is the distributive property?

Back

The distributive property states that a(b + c) = ab + ac, allowing you to multiply a single term by two or more terms inside a set of parentheses.
